An international law enforcement operation coordinated by the FBI led to the seizure of the notorious BreachForums hacking forum. BreachForums is a cybercrime forum used by threat actors to purchase, sell, and exchange stolen data, including credentials, and personal and financial information. In March 2023, U.S.

Three hacking forums Nulled.ch, Sinfulsite.com, and suxx.to have been hacked and their databases have been leaked online. Researchers from intelligence firm Cyble made the headlines again, this time they have discovered online the databases of three hacking forums. The databases appear to have been leaking in May 2020.
